On Monday, November 26, 2012 03:41:22 PM MyungJoo Ham wrote:
Dear Rafael, sorry for the inconviences; I forgot that I've updated the tag name according to the date modified. Please use "pull_req_20121122" tag instead of "pull_req_20121121" though I've pushed pull_req_20121121 tag again, which points to the same commit with pull_req_20121122 tag. "remove compiler error" patch in this set should resolve the "build failure" message sent by Stephen as well.
It looks like you rebased it on top of linux-next, didn't you? Please don't do that, linux-next is evolving and the commit hashes in there are changing over time. I've merged your previous pull request into my pm-devfreq branch and pushed it out. Please rebase your new material on top of my pm-devfreq branch and resubmit. Thanks, Rafael
